I always like seeing progress photos so here are some of mine. I had surgery on 4/20/12 and have lost 85 lbs. A few of those were pre-op.

I eat 600-700 calories a day that I track on MFP/min of 60 protein/min 64 oz water/max 25 carbs.

I have totally got this! My only regret is that I didn't pick out a more attractive "progress photo" outfit. :)

Hi Holli,

I was sleeved on 4/25 and have only lost 43lbs. I had to resch my 90 day appt to the end of this month because I was sick when I was supposed to go in July so I dont know how many calories I should be eating now. I've got my MFP account set at 800 but could actually go over that (and have sometimes). Is 600-700 calories what your surgeon wants you to be on right now or are you just going by what works for you right now? I wonder if I should be trying to keep closer to what you are eating? I know its different for everyone but my losses are VERY slow. I might be eating too much...?
